WebRobbery Armed with an Offensive Weapon (maximum penalty = 20 years imprisonment) This is a robbery involving a knife, or any other weapon. A weapon can include things such as a baseball bat, stick, scissors, a syringe, or any object that is used or intended to be used to threaten someone with harm.
